Turkey-Sudan educational cooperation
Overview
Turkey and Sudan have initiated efforts to strengthen bilateral educational ties through high-level diplomatic and academic cooperation.
Following meetings between Turkish National Education Minister Yusuf Tekin and Sudanese Education Minister Tuhami El-Zain Hajar, both nations expressed intent to formalize relations via a memorandum of understanding. Initial discussions focused on vocational and technical training, teacher training, digital infrastructure reconstruction, and the establishment of Turkish language courses.
This cooperation progressed to a formal framework protocol signed between Anadolu University and the Republic of Sudan. Under this agreement, Anadolu University will provide academic content, digital resources, and assessment support for Turkish language instruction within Sudan’s National Languages Center (SENSEL-SELTI), while also assisting in the training of local Sudanese educators.
